| BIEN_ranges_species | R Documentation | 
BIEN_ranges_species extracts range maps for the specified species.
BIEN_ranges_species(
  species,
  directory = NULL,
  matched = TRUE,
  match_names_only = FALSE,
  include.gid = FALSE,
  ...
)
| species | A single species or a vector of species. | 
| directory | Directory that range maps should be saved in. If none is specified, range maps will be saved in the current working directory. | 
| matched | Return a list of taxa that were downloaded. Default is TRUE. | 
| match_names_only | Check for range maps for the taxa specified without downloading range maps. Default is FALSE. | 
| include.gid | Should the files returned have a unique GID appended to them? This is needed if downloading multiple maps for the same species. | 
| ... | Additional arguments passed to internal functions. | 
Range maps for specified species.
Details on the construction of BIEN range maps is available at https://bien.nceas.ucsb.edu/bien/biendata/bien-3/

## Not run: 
library(sf)
library(maps) #a convenient source of maps
species_vector <- c("Abies_lasiocarpa","Abies_amabilis")
BIEN_ranges_species(species_vector)
BIEN_ranges_species(species_vector, match_names_only = TRUE)
temp_dir <- file.path(tempdir(), "BIEN_temp")#Set a working directory
BIEN_ranges_species(species = species_vector,
                    directory = temp_dir)#saves ranges to a temporary directory
BIEN_ranges_species("Abies_lasiocarpa")
BIEN_ranges_species("Abies_lasiocarpa",
                    directory = temp_dir)
#Reading files
Abies_poly <- st_read(dsn = temp_dir,
                      layer = "Abies_lasiocarpa")
#Plotting files
plot(Abies_poly[1])#plots the range, but doesn't mean much without any reference
map('world', fill = TRUE, col = "grey")#plots a world map (WGS84 projection), in grey
plot(Abies_poly[1],
     col = "forest green",
     add = TRUE) #adds the range of Abies lasiocarpa to the map
# Getting data from the files (currently only species names and a BIEN ID field)
Abies_poly$species#gives the species name associated with "Abies_poly"
## End(Not run)#'
